Camp activities for children with special needs
In the course of vacations children with special needs are left without an adequate framework because of the high costs of camp activities and the fact that they are not suited to their needs.
That is why the Jerusalem Variety Center runs, in the course of the holidays, camps for children with special needs for a token tuition fee only.
The camp activities focus on a specific theme. The theme of the summer camp this year, for instance, was around the world in 21 days. Every day the activity was dedicated to a different country.

The camps also offer outdoor activities such as swimming, a visit to the zoo and the Israel Museum.
Some 100 children took part in our summer camp this year, including children with blindness and vision impaired, deaf and hearing impaired, children with autism and with communication impairments, children with mild to moderate mental retardation, children with learning disabilities, children from shelters for battered women and children at risk.
